[Reporter Ge Youhao/Kaohsiung Report] Gangmingli, Xiaogang District, and Nanyanli, Yanchao District, Kaohsiung City were re-electioned today (19th) due to the death of the head-elect before the inauguration. Due to fierce competition, the turnout rate in both li exceeded 45%. .

As a result of the balloting in the evening, Hong Kong Mingli was elected by Li Hongyi with 545 votes; Nanyanli was elected by Gong Yingyu with 916 votes.

The Gaoshi Election Committee stated that Li Wenzheng, the elected head of Gangming Village in Xiaogang District, passed away on November 28 last year; Gong Rongyuan, the elected head of Nanyan Village in Yanchao District, passed away on December 19 last year; If a person dies before taking office, the village head should complete the re-election vote within 3 months from the date of death.

The Election Committee of Kaohsiung City today (19th) held the voting for the two mile lengths. The voting time was from 8:00 am to 4:00 pm. After the voting deadline, the votes were counted immediately, and the counting of votes was successfully completed at 5:30 pm.

According to the results of ballot counting, the number of votes for candidates in Gangmingli, Xiaogang District: No. 1 Xu Haoheng 218 votes, No. 2 Chen Yuanquan 47 votes, No. 3 Deng Chunshan 76 votes, No. 4 Li Weiqun 297 votes, No. 5 Li Hongyi 545 votes, No. 6 Chen Jucai 123 votes.

Turnout was 45.8%.

Candidates in Nanyanli, Yanchao District received 150 votes for No. 1 Wang Jianshun, 726 votes for No. 2 Gao Cigang, and 916 votes for No. 3 Gong Yingyu.

Turnout was 48.38%.

The Kaohsiung City Election Committee stated that the list of elected candidates will be submitted to the committee meeting for deliberation and approval, and the list of elected candidates will be announced on February 24 according to law.

In addition, Zhong Cuimin, the head-elect of Haiguang District, Fengshan District, works as a nurse in a military hospital and is a contracted employee of the Ministry of National Defense. He is subject to the regulations on the appointment of contracted personnel of the Ministry of Defense. After being identified, a by-election is tentatively scheduled to be held on March 11. Four people, including Wu Liang Yuefeng, Wang Tingyou, Liao Guozhi, and Su Liru, have registered to run for the election.
